Violet was born in 1891 to parents Edgar and Elizabeth (nee Langley) at Pine Creek, near Terowie, in the mining district of South Australia that included Burra.
In 1892 Violet's father was in the Burra Hospital for a long time. Afterwards he took a position as keeper of the Troubridge lighthouse, and was again away from home. When he returned he took Violet, aged 3, and her brother away from their mother whom he accused of an adulterous affair. They did not see her from 1894 to 1900. Violet's father continued as a lighthousekeeper at various locations.
In 1900, Edgar divorced Elizabeth and gained custody of the children. At this time he was a lighthouse keeper at Cape Jervis.
In 1902, when Violet was 11 yrs, her father remarried, to Emma Cole, but no more children were born.
In 1908, a few days before her 17th birthday, Violet married grazier Archibald Buick of Kangaroo Island. When they returned from their honeymoon, this notice appeared in the Kangaroo Island Courier:
AN IMPROMPTU RECEPTION, Quite a novel trip was enjoyed by those who were fortunate enough to be on the Karatta on Saturday last when Mr and Mrs A. O. Buick re- turned to Hog Bay from their honey- moon. Their healths were toasted and drank enthusiastically by all present and speeches were given by Mr R. L. Barrett (Kingsoote) and Mr L. E. Clark (Hog Bay). Mr Buick responded on behalf of himself and his wife. Altogether a thoroughly enjoyable time was spent at the impromptu banquet. The bunting which decor- ated the Karatta was taken down on her arrival here. The recent novel wedding at (near) Kingscote, added to this banqueting tend to something of the 'roman- tique' in Kangaroo Island weddings. The Kangaroo Island Courier (Kingscote, SA : 1907 - 1951), Sat 4 Jul 1908, Page 6, HOG BAY NOTES
Violet gave birth to 9 children.
She died in 1951 and is buried with her husband in the Kingscote Cemetery on Kangaroo Island.

Death of father: PAYNE.— On the 11th December, at Delamere, Edgar Samuel Payne, second son of the late Arthur Payne, of Payneham and Noarlunga, aged 63 years. The Register (Adelaide, SA : 1901 - 1929), Wed 16 Dec 1925, Page 8, Family Notices
Father- Obituary
Mr. Edgar Samuel Payne.
Mr. Edgar Samuel Payne, who died at
Delamere on December 11 had been a
patient sufferer for many years.
He was a son of the late
Mr. Arthur Payne, formerly of
Payneham and Noarlunga, and a grand-
son of the original owner of the well
known Exchange Hotel in Hindley street,
Adelaide. Owing to declining family for
tunes some years ago, Mr. E. S. Payne and
his brothers had to look afield for their
living, and he selected the lighthouse ser-
vice, and carried out the duties at Capes
Jaffa, Jervis, and Banks. He was twice
married, and has left a widow, a son
Mr. Arthur Payne, and a daughter, Mrs.
Violet Buick, of Kangaroo Island.
